Frank Golembrosky

Frank Golembrosky (born May 3, 1945) is a Canadian former professional ice hockey player who played in the World Hockey Association (WHA).[1] Golembrosky played part of the 1972–73 WHA season with the Philadelphia Blazers and Quebec Nordiques.[1]
